- 1、本文档共66页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
数据字典-动态数据字典 Oracle包含了一些潜在的由系统管理员如SYS维护的表和视图,由于当数据库运行的时候它们会不断进行更新,所以称它们为动态数据字典(或者是动态性能视图)。这些视图提供了关于内存和磁盘的运行情况,所以我们只能对其进行只读访问而不能修改它们。 小结 1、Oracle体系结构 (1)、按存储结构分类:?物理存储结构 ?逻辑存储结构 (2)、按实例结构分类:内存结构和进程结构 2、Oracle体系中的数据字典 Thank you! * 参见王海军P211 SGA按其作用不同,可以分为以下几个主要部分: 共享池(Shared Pool)。 数据缓冲区(Database Buffer Cache)。 日志缓冲区(RedoLog Buffer Cache)。 Java池(可选)(Java Pool)。 大型池(可选)(Lager Pool)。 说明: SGA的尺寸应小于物理内存的一半。 在Oracle系统中,所有用户与Oracle数据库系统的数据交换都要经过SGA区。 内存结构-系统全局区(SGA) 共享池(Shared Pool) 共享池保存了最近执行的SQL语句、PL/SQL程序和数据字典信息,是对SQL语句和PL/SQL程序进行语法分析、编译和执行的内存区。 共享池 数据字典缓存器:收集最近使用的数据库中的数据定义信息(它包含数据文件、表、索引、列、用户、访问权限、其他数据库对象等)。 库高速缓存器 共享PL/SQL区 共享SQL区 内存结构-系统全局区(SGA) 共享池的大小可以通过初始化参数文件(通常为init.ora)中的shared_pool_size决定。共享池是活动非常频繁的内存结构,会产生大量的内存碎片,所以要确保它尽可能足够大。查看共享池大小可通过SHOW PARAMETER语句来实现,操作如下: SQL SHOW PARAMETER shared_pool_size; NAME TYPW VALUE shared_pool_size big integer 20M SQL ALTER SYSTEM SET shared_pool_size = 15M; System altered. 内存结构-系统全局区(SGA) 数据缓冲区(Database Buffer Cache) 数据缓冲区 功能:存储数据文件中数据块的拷贝 数据交换方式:最近最少使用算法(LRU) 大小:由参数db_cache_size决定 查看参数方式:SHOW PARAMETER语句 内存结构-系统全局区(SGA) 可以通过ALTER SYSTEM SET修改数据缓冲区容量大小。操作如下: SQL SHOW PARAMETER db_cache_size; NAME TYPW VALUE db_cache_size big integer 20M SQL ALTER SYSTEM SET db_cache_size = 15M; ?? System altered. 数据缓冲区(Database Buffer Cache) 内存结构-系统全局区(SGA) 日志缓冲区(Database Buffer Cache) 日志缓冲区 形状:环状的缓存器 功能:存储数据库的修改操作信息,恢复 数据库信息。 大小:由参数log_buffer决定 内存结构-系统全局区(SGA) 可以通过SHOW PARAMETER语句查看该参数的信息。操作如下: SQL SHOW PARAMETER log_buffer; NAME TYPW VALUE log_buffer integer 5654016 日志缓冲区(Database Buffer Cache) 内存结构-系统全局区(SGA) Java池 java池 功能:为执行Java命令提供分析与执行内存空间。 大小:由参数java_pool_size决定 查看参数信息方式:SHOW PARAMETER语句 内存结构-系统全局区(SGA) Java池 可以通过ALTER SYSTEM SET修改Java池容量大小。操作如下: SQL SHOW PARAMETER java_pool_size; NAME TYPW
您可能关注的文档
- 第6章_图表处理_Excel2007版教材重点.ppt
- 毛细管气相色谱法重点.ppt
- 方淞线拓宽施工组织设计重点.doc
- 第2课词语输入方法多重点.ppt
- 赵实习报告剖析.doc
- 第6章_字符串重点.ppt
- 第2课时_元素的性质与原子结构(36张)重点.ppt
- 第2课时《他们这样做的原因》重点.ppt
- 证据的基本原理剖析.pptx
- 设计与生活的关系剖析.ppt
- [中央]2023年中国电子学会招聘应届生笔试历年参考题库附带答案详解.docx
- [吉安]2023年江西吉安市青原区总工会招聘协理员笔试历年参考题库附带答案详解.docx
- [中央]中华预防医学会科普信息部工作人员招聘笔试历年参考题库附带答案详解.docx
- [保定]河北保定市第二医院招聘工作人员49人笔试历年参考题库附带答案详解.docx
- [南通]江苏南通市崇川区人民法院招聘专职人民调解员10人笔试历年参考题库附带答案详解.docx
- [厦门]2023年福建厦门市机关事务管理局非在编工作人员招聘笔试历年参考题库附带答案详解.docx
- [三明]2023年福建三明市尤溪县招聘小学幼儿园新任教师79人笔试历年参考题库附带答案详解.docx
- [哈尔滨]2023年黑龙江哈尔滨市木兰县调配事业单位工作人员笔试历年参考题库附带答案详解.docx
- [上海]2023年上海市气象局所属事业单位招聘笔试历年参考题库附带答案详解.docx
- [台州]2023年浙江台州椒江区招聘中小学教师40人笔试历年参考题库附带答案详解.docx
文档评论(0)